The 18-mile (each way) drive takes about 3 hours in total and gains 1,221 feet up to Rainbow Point, the highest point in the park at 9,115 feet. We recommend you drive all the way from Sunrise Point to Rainbow Point (north to south) and then wind back up towards Sunrise Point (south to north) while stopping at various viewpoints on the way. The lofty Aquarius and Table Cliff Plateaus rise along the skyline to the northeast; you can see the same colorful Claron Formation in cliffs that faulting has raised about 2,000 feet (610 m) higher. Precipitation falling west of the rim flows gently into the East Fork of the Sevier River and the Great Basin; precipitation landing east of the rim rushes through deep canyons in the Pink Cliffs to the Paria River and on to the Colorado River and the Grand Canyon. Dubbed by many the most scenic road in America, Utah State Route 12 extends 122 miles east to west and connects Bryce Canyon with Kodachrome Basin State Park, Grand Staircase National Monument, Capitol Reef National Park, and several other recreation areas.Along the way, you'll see red canyons, grey canyons, orange tunnels, and intimidating drop-offs along Calf Creek Canyon. The two-lane, paved route begins at the park entrance just south of Bryce Canyon City ($30/car valid 7 days, accepts NPS passes) and then skirts the Bryce Canyon amphitheater of hoodoos for 18 miles until it ends at Rainbow Point. The shuttle can be boarded at Ruby’s Inn, Ruby’s Campground, Shuttle Parking and Boarding Area, Bryce Canyon Lodge, North Campground, and Sunset Campground.
